Sorry, this came up after I submitted and after picking up into
Precise. Currently the installer uses a special handling to find
the multipath module(s). The get rid of that deviation to Debian
it would be good to have them in their own udeb.

Subject: [PATCH] UBUNTU: d-i: Move multipath modules into their own udeb

BugLink: http://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/959749

Signed-off-by: Stefan Bader <stefan.bader at canonical.com>
---
 debian.master/d-i/modules/md-modules        |    1 -
 debian.master/d-i/modules/multipath-modules |    2 ++
 debian.master/d-i/package-list              |    6 ++++++
 3 files changed, 8 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)
 create mode 100644 debian.master/d-i/modules/multipath-modules

diff --git a/debian.master/d-i/modules/md-modules b/debian.master/d-i/modules/md-modules
index 9b43a3f..18d0214 100644
--- a/debian.master/d-i/modules/md-modules
+++ b/debian.master/d-i/modules/md-modules
@@ -1,4 +1,3 @@
-dm-multipath ?
 dm-crypt ?
 dm-zero ?
 faulty ?
diff --git a/debian.master/d-i/modules/multipath-modules b/debian.master/d-i/modules/multipath-modules
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..3516fde
--- /dev/null
+++ b/debian.master/d-i/modules/multipath-modules
@@ -0,0 +1,2 @@
+dm-multipath ?
+dm-round-robin ?
diff --git a/debian.master/d-i/package-list b/debian.master/d-i/package-list
index b977acd..e899056 100644
--- a/debian.master/d-i/package-list
+++ b/debian.master/d-i/package-list
@@ -188,3 +188,9 @@ Depends: kernel-image
 Priority: standard
 Description: ipmi modules
 
+Package: multipath-modules
+Depends: kernel-image
+Priority: extra
+Description: DM-Multipath support
+  This package contains modules for device-mapper multipath support.
+
